Cataracts
A medical condition characterized by clouding of the lens in the eye, leading to decreased vision.
Glaucoma
A group of eye conditions that damage the optic nerve, often caused by abnormally high pressure in the eye, leading to loss of vision if not treated.
Macular Degeneration
A medical condition which results in blurred or no vision in the center of the visual field due to damage to the macula, often related to aging.
